Deveon Everhart[3] is an American professional wrestler, currently signed to Impact Wrestling under the ring name Dezmond Xavier.[4] He also performs on the independent scene, mostly notably for Pro Wrestling Guerrilla (PWG), where he is currently one-half of the PWG World Tag Team Champions in his first reign with partner Zachary Wentz.

Professional wrestling career

Impact Wrestling (2017–present)

On April 13, 2017, it was reported that Dezmond Xavier had signed with Impact Wrestling.[5] On the April 20 episode of Impact Wrestling, Xavier made his debut in a six-way match for the Impact X Division Championship, in which he was unsuccessful.[6] In July, Xavier entered the 2017 GFW Super X Cup tournament,[7] defeated Idris Abraham in the quarterfinals, Drago in the semifinals, and Taiji Ishimori in the final to win the 2017 GFW Super X Cup.[8]

Dragon Gate (2018)

Dragon Gate announced the debut of Xavier and his indy tag team partner Zachary Wentz at Open The New Year Gate, Dragon Gate's first show of 2018. They debuted on 13 January, where Xavier and Wentz, collectively known as Scarlet and Graves, teamed with Susumu Yokosuka in a winning effort against Genki Horiguchi, Flamita and Bandido

Lucha Underground (2018–present)

On the July 18th, 2018, episode of Lucha Underground he made his debut under the name Dezmond X defeating Paul London for one of the seven ancient Aztec Medallions.
